How I Decided If 2000 BTU Was Enough
The first thing I checked was the size of the space I wanted to cool. I learned quickly that BTU matters a lot. If the room is too large, a 2000 BTU unit will struggle and I would not expect strong results. For me, this size only works when I need targeted cooling in a very small area. I always compare the room size, heat level, and insulation before buying.

Energy Use and Operating Cost
I always think about electricity use before I buy any AC unit. A small 2000 BTU model should be efficient, but I still check the wattage and power source. If I plan to use it often, I want a unit that cools well without driving up my energy bill. For me, low power consumption is one of the biggest advantages of a unit this size.
Noise Level Matters to Me
Because I usually want a small AC unit for personal comfort, noise is a big deal. I prefer something quiet enough for sleeping, working, or relaxing. I look for decibel ratings if they are available, and I read reviews to see if the fan or compressor is annoying in real use.

Installation and Setup
I prefer a unit that is simple to install. Some small AC units are plug-and-play, while others still need venting or drainage. I always ask myself how much effort I want to spend on setup. If I want convenience, I look for a design that is easy to operate right out of the box.
